• Full Time
  • Overal
  • 4 weken geleden geplaatst

Display Team Lead. Pure Player, Amsterdam.

As Display Team Lead, you are responsible for setting and implementing our display advertising strategy and affiliate marketing across 7 markets with a view to meet ambitious goals. In addition, this role includes a cross functional responsibility as mobile acquisition lead across online channels. As such you will be part of our mobile group, which includes team members from various departments and will represent the online marketing team and channels.

Bekijk volledige vacature

Do you want to implement and manage display advertising campaigns across various ad-serving platforms? Does the idea of working in a motivated team excite you and are you constantly willing to share knowledge and bring the team to a next level? Then you might be our new: Display Team Lead.

Join one of the fastest growing e-commerce companies in Amsterdam and work together with an international team that is passionate about inspiring people to relive and share life’s moments through personalized photo products. With customer centricity at their core, they are driven by quality, creativity, innovation, development, and providing the best customer experience anytime, anywhere.

The Position

Together with two other specialists, the Display Team Lead is part of the Online Marketing Team (OMT) and reports to the Online Marketing Manager. The OMT is a young and dynamic group of people of ~15 professionals (SEM, SEO, Display- and Affiliate Marketing) with big ambitions and a true passion for online marketing. The OMT is responsible for the online marketing strategy and execution for all our brands across Europe.

As Display Team Lead, you are responsible for setting and implementing our display advertising strategy and affiliate marketing across 7 markets with a view to meet ambitious goals. In addition, this role includes a cross functional responsibility as mobile acquisition lead across online channels. As such you will be part of our mobile group, which includes team members from various departments and will represent the online marketing team and channels.

Key Responsibilities

  • Lead team to scale and optimize digital marketing and media campaigns across the our portfolio of brands
  • Use data to optimize large budgets and bids and to expand, evolve, and optimize media programs
  • Provide thought leadership, strategic insight, and clear communication (written and verbal) to team members on strategy

Requirements

For this position, we are looking for someone with an enthusiastic and proactive character who can quickly pick up the business, set priorities and take ownership of the display advertising portfolio. You are analytical, autonomous and have strong experience within Display Advertisement, especially retargeting and Facebook.

You also have:

  • A Bachelor’s or Master’s degree
  • A minimum of 5 years of online marketing experience
  • At least 1-2 years experience leading/ managing others
  • You have experience in at least one or more ad serving, bid management and campaign management tools (doubleclick, appnexus, turn etc.)
  • Demonstrated ability of developing and growing Display Marketing portfolio
  • Exceptional ability to communicate complex ideas in a simple manner
  • Extensive knowledge of Facebook marketing
  • Mobile/ App experience strongly preferred
  • Solid knowledge of Affiliate marketing
  • Strong organizational and time-management skills, with ability to handle multiple and changing priorities
  • Fluent in English (written and verbal)
  • Good/excellent knowledge of a second language (Dutch, Swedish, German or Norwegian) would be a plus

Offer

This high-impact role is challenging, as we have high expectations, but at the same time rewarding. We provide a highly competitive compensation package including perks, and an atmosphere with a lot of opportunities to develop yourself. You will work in an international environment with more than 33 different nationalities. They are located in the exciting heart of Amsterdam, The Netherlands. The office is just a 2-minute walk from Amsterdam Central Station.

Do you want to implement and manage display advertising campaigns across various ad-serving platforms? Does the idea of working in a motivated team excite you and are you constantly willing to share knowledge and bring the team to a next level? Then you might be our new: Display Team Lead.

Join one of the fastest growing e-commerce companies in Amsterdam and work together with an international team that is passionate about inspiring people to relive and share life’s moments through personalized photo products. With customer centricity at their core, they are driven by quality, creativity, innovation, development, and providing the best customer experience anytime, anywhere.

The Position

Together with two other specialists, the Display Team Lead is part of the Online Marketing Team (OMT) and reports to the Online Marketing Manager. The OMT is a young and dynamic group of people of ~15 professionals (SEM, SEO, Display- and Affiliate Marketing) with big ambitions and a true passion for online marketing. The OMT is responsible for the online marketing strategy and execution for all our brands across Europe.

As Display Team Lead, you are responsible for setting and implementing our display advertising strategy and affiliate marketing across 7 markets with a view to meet ambitious goals. In addition, this role includes a cross functional responsibility as mobile acquisition lead across online channels. As such you will be part of our mobile group, which includes team members from various departments and will represent the online marketing team and channels.

Key Responsibilities

  • Lead team to scale and optimize digital marketing and media campaigns across the our portfolio of brands
  • Use data to optimize large budgets and bids and to expand, evolve, and optimize media programs
  • Provide thought leadership, strategic insight, and clear communication (written and verbal) to team members on strategy

Requirements

For this position, we are looking for someone with an enthusiastic and proactive character who can quickly pick up the business, set priorities and take ownership of the display advertising portfolio. You are analytical, autonomous and have strong experience within Display Advertisement, especially retargeting and Facebook.

You also have:

  • A Bachelor’s or Master’s degree
  • A minimum of 5 years of online marketing experience
  • At least 1-2 years experience leading/ managing others
  • You have experience in at least one or more ad serving, bid management and campaign management tools (doubleclick, appnexus, turn etc.)
  • Demonstrated ability of developing and growing Display Marketing portfolio
  • Exceptional ability to communicate complex ideas in a simple manner
  • Extensive knowledge of Facebook marketing
  • Mobile/ App experience strongly preferred
  • Solid knowledge of Affiliate marketing
  • Strong organizational and time-management skills, with ability to handle multiple and changing priorities
  • Fluent in English (written and verbal)
  • Good/excellent knowledge of a second language (Dutch, Swedish, German or Norwegian) would be a plus

Offer

This high-impact role is challenging, as we have high expectations, but at the same time rewarding. We provide a highly competitive compensation package including perks, and an atmosphere with a lot of opportunities to develop yourself. You will work in an international environment with more than 33 different nationalities. They are located in the exciting heart of Amsterdam, The Netherlands. The office is just a 2-minute walk from Amsterdam Central Station.

Geïnteresseerd?

Kiki Verhoeven06-46316309
Alle vacatures

Geïnteresseerd?

Onze Digital Successen

Een overzicht van onze successen. De rollen die wij afgelopen periode hebben ingevuld met digital specialisten. Klik op onderstaande button voor onze Digital Successen!

Onze successen

Deel deze vacature

Geen passende vacature?

Neem dan contact op.

Contact